I was going to search the junkyard and I was told that there are 7.5 rear end posi's in mustangs that I can swap in. Is this true? Also, I currently have a 4cylinder automatic 98 XLT 2wd ranger which has 4.11 gears in the rear. Could I swap a set of 3.73 gears in there for better gas mileage? WILL it get better gas mileage? And if so, what parts would I need? I am sure I would need the gear for the tranny etc? Thanks for any help guys!!!
 
I doubt a switch to 3.73s will increase your mileage much, if at all. It will certainly make your truck more sluggish though. I'd hang onto the 4.10 rearend.
